T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
-The WKF rules will apply.
Gum shields as well as red and blue mitts are compulsory.
Shin and foot protectors (blue/red) must be worn for all kumite events.
Cadet Kata competitors must be able to perform 2 Shitei Kata and 3 Free Choice Kata in the individual and team events (application of Kata in the final round of the team event will not be required).
Junior Kata Competitors must be able to perform 2 Shitei Kata and 5 Free Choice Kata in individual and team events (application in final round of Team Kata must be performed)
